Science and Engineer Importance to Singapore

Singapore has boosted its water supply through water-recycling and also increased its land area by reclaiming land, all feats accomplished by engineers. And engineering will continue to be important for Singapore's future, as the country works towards becoming a smart nation and overcoming its lack of resources
Prime Minister Lee Hsien Loong
(50th anniversary celebration of the IES)
